Subject: Partner SFTP drop — new owner

Hi,

As you review the pending changes to the Harborline ingest scripts, note that ownership of the partner SFTP drop is changing at the end of the month. This includes key rotation, the nightly pull job, and the quarantine folder for malformed files. Review comments on the retry logic should still go through the normal PR flow, but questions about drop-folder conventions or partner onboarding now go to the new owner. The incoming owner is listed below.

signatory, tagaf-bahaf: Praael Fenmir Rusok

## Onboarding — DigestWorks Scheduling

New team members: the DigestWorks batch email digests run nightly from the Fennick scheduler. If the scheduler account locks during a timezone rollover, use the recovery console rather than resetting credentials manually, since manual resets break the cron manifest. The console requires the recovery passphrase, which is kept on the line below.

vault phrase of bagaf-kajeg = jorath-feniel-briir-siliel-ralix

Re: Retirement of the Stonebriar product line

Stonebriar sales have declined for five consecutive quarters and support costs now exceed contribution margin. The retirement plan is staged: new orders close end of Q2, existing contracts honoured through their terms, and spares stocked for twenty-four months. Sales leads should steer prospects toward the Ashgrove range; migration incentives are already approved. Customer comms are drafted and awaiting legal sign-off. The forward strategy behind this decision is set out in the note below.

confidential, yafog-hagug: Gross margin on Druix came in at 10 percent against a plan of 15 percent. Only 5 of the 80 pilot accounts renewed Druix, so a churn review is set for October 1.